Many main U.S. cities have seen residence costs soar previously 12 months, at the same time as the standard American has seen pandemic-era hire inflation cool considerably.

For instance, renters in Syracuse, New York, noticed month-to-month rents for one- and two-bedroom flats available on the market leap essentially the most relative to different huge cities: by 29% and 25%, respectively, since June 2023, in keeping with information in Zumper’s Nationwide Hire Report.

Zumper analyzed median asking rents for residence listings within the largest 100 U.S. cities by inhabitants.

Rents have additionally risen by at the least 10% for each one- and two-bedroom flats in different main metros: Lincoln, Nebraska; Chicago; Buffalo, New York; Madison, Wisconsin; Rochester, New York; and New York Metropolis, in keeping with Zumper.

Conversely, renters in different cities are seeing aid.

Asking rents for one-bedroom flats have declined by at the least 5% in Oakland, California; Memphis and Chattanooga, Tennessee; Cincinnati, Ohio; Colorado Springs, Colorado; Irving, Texas; Jacksonville, Florida; and Raleigh, Greensboro and Durham, North Carolina, in keeping with the evaluation.

By comparability, nationwide costs total for one- and two-bedroom flats are up 1.5% and a pair of.1%, respectively, since June 2023, Zumper discovered.

New York is the costliest metro for renters: The standard renter pays $4,300 a month for a one-bedroom residence, it discovered.

By comparability, in Akron, Ohio, and Wichita, Kansas — which tied for the bottom big-city rents — renters pay $730 a month for a one-bedroom residence.

What causes hire inflation

At a excessive stage, hire inflation is guided by supply-and-demand dynamics, stated Crystal Chen, an analyst who authored the Zumper evaluation.

Mainly, areas with fast-growing rents are seeing demand outstrip the availability of obtainable flats, whereas these with falling rents have seen their residence inventories rising.

For instance, the residence emptiness price in New York Metropolis just lately dropped to 1.4%, a historic low courting to the Sixties, in keeping with the New York Metropolis Division of Housing Preservation and Growth. The emptiness price “nosedived” from 4.5% simply two years in the past, the company stated.

“The data is clear, the demand to live in our city is far outpacing our ability to build housing,” New York Metropolis Mayor Eric Adams stated in an announcement in regards to the emptiness price.

Swelling rents can current monetary challenges for households.

In Could, a typical renter would have spent virtually 30% of their revenue on a brand new rental, in keeping with Zillow.

Whereas down from a latest peak close to 31% in June 2022, it exceeds the roughly 28% that was widespread earlier than the pandemic, in keeping with Zillow information.

About 86% of New York Metropolis residents with the bottom revenue (lower than $25,000 a 12 months) are severely hire burdened, in keeping with the New York Metropolis Division of Housing Preservation and Growth. A rise in monetary pressure has triggered “an alarming increase in missed rent payments and arrears” relative to 2021, it stated.

Excessive rents can produce other cascading impacts.

For instance, they could restrict the power of potential homebuyers to save lots of for a down fee, “keeping them on the sidelines of the housing market,” Fitch stated in a world housing outlook.

Hire inflation has fallen considerably

Hire inflation plummeted within the early days of the Covid-19 pandemic.

“Pretty much everyone” sheltered in place throughout the well being disaster, and digital nomads who now not needed to work in a bodily workplace left cities in favor of the suburbs and out of doors areas, Chen stated.

Nevertheless, rents spiked by 2022 and into 2023 amid return-to-office insurance policies and as individuals moved again to greater cities, Chen stated.

Annual hire inflation largely hovered between 3% and 4% the the years main as much as the pandemic, and peaked round 9% in early 2023, in keeping with the buyer worth index. It has step by step cooled since then, to about 5% in Could, in keeping with shopper worth index information.
